Ravshan Kulob (Tajik: Равшан Кӯлоб, Persian: باشگاه فوتبال روشن کولاب) is a professional football club based in Kulob, Tajikistan, formed in 1965 as FK Ansol Kulob.[3] The club was renamed FK Olimp-Ansol Kulob in 2003,[3] before changing to its current name in 2005.[3] They currently play in the Ligai Olii Tojikiston and play their home matches at Kulob Markazii Stadium.
